It was slow offensively for both teams to start, after a 5-3 end to the first quarter. However, the pace picked up in the second with the Bears and Sabers each finding their strides.
Souhegan’s Caroline Drum and Zofia Rosenfield led the way for their team in scoring. And while the Bears kept it close, the collective defensive effort by the Sabers is what helped them prevail down the stretch.
